博客 高校可视化大屏的数据采集与实时渲染技术实现

高校可视化大屏的数据采集与实时渲染技术实现

   数栈君   发表于 2025-08-20 15:08  147  0

在数字化转型的浪潮中,高校可视化大屏作为一种高效的数据展示和决策支持工具,正在被越来越多的教育机构所采用。通过实时数据的采集与渲染,高校可视化大屏能够为校园管理、教学监控、科研分析等场景提供直观、动态的信息支持。本文将深入探讨高校可视化大屏的数据采集与实时渲染技术实现,为企业和个人提供实用的技术参考。


一、数据采集技术

1. 数据源的多样性

高校可视化大屏的数据来源广泛,主要包括以下几种:

  • 传感器数据:如校园内的温湿度传感器、空气质量传感器等。
  • 摄像头数据:用于监控校园安全的视频流数据。
  • 数据库数据:包括学生信息、课程安排、科研数据等结构化数据。
  • API接口数据:从第三方系统(如教务系统、图书馆系统)获取实时数据。
  • 物联网设备数据:如智能门禁、智能灯控等设备的运行数据。

2. 数据采集的挑战

在高校环境中,数据采集面临以下挑战:

  • 异构系统集成:高校通常使用多种不同的信息系统,数据格式和接口协议不统一。
  • 数据实时性要求高:部分场景(如校园安全监控)需要实时数据支持,延迟过高会影响决策效果。
  • 数据量大:高校的师生规模较大,数据采集量也随之增加。

3. 数据采集的实现方案

为应对上述挑战,可以采用以下技术方案:

  • 基于MQTT协议的物联网数据采集:MQTT是一种轻量级的物联网协议,适合实时数据传输。
  • 数据清洗与预处理:在采集端对数据进行初步清洗,确保数据的准确性和完整性。
  • 数据格式转换:将不同来源的数据统一转换为适合后续处理的格式(如JSON、CSV)。

二、数据处理与分析

1. 数据处理的实时性

高校可视化大屏的核心需求之一是实时性。为了满足这一需求,数据处理过程需要尽可能高效:

  • 流数据处理:采用流处理技术(如Apache Kafka、Flink),实时处理数据流。
  • 边缘计算:在数据源附近部署边缘计算节点,减少数据传输延迟。

2. 数据分析与特征提取

在数据采集之后,需要对数据进行分析和特征提取,以便为可视化提供有意义的信息:

  • 统计分析:对历史数据进行统计分析,提取关键指标(如学生出勤率、设备故障率)。
  • 机器学习模型:利用机器学习算法对数据进行预测和分类,例如预测校园设备的故障概率。

三、实时渲染技术

1. 渲染引擎的选择

实时渲染是高校可视化大屏的核心技术之一。常见的渲染引擎包括:

  • WebGL:基于OpenGL的Web图形库,适合Web端渲染。
  • WebAssembly:用于高性能计算,可以加速数据处理和渲染。
  • Direct3D:微软的DirectX技术,适合Windows环境。

2. 数据可视化方法

在高校可视化大屏中,数据可视化需要兼顾美观和实用性:

  • 图表可视化:如折线图、柱状图、饼图等,适合展示统计数据。
  • 地理信息系统(GIS):用于展示校园地理分布数据。
  • 三维可视化:通过三维建模技术,展示校园建筑、设备分布等信息。

3. 实时渲染的优化

为了确保渲染的流畅性,可以采取以下优化措施:

  • 硬件加速:利用GPU进行图形渲染,提升渲染性能。
  • 动态分辨率调整:根据网络带宽和设备性能,动态调整渲染分辨率。
  • 数据分片:将大规模数据分成多个小块,分片渲染以减少卡顿。

四、高校可视化大屏的系统架构

1. 分层架构设计

高校可视化大屏的系统架构通常采用分层设计:

  • 数据采集层:负责采集各种数据源。
  • 数据处理层:对数据进行清洗、分析和特征提取。
  • 渲染层:将数据转化为可视化界面。
  • 用户交互层:提供人机交互界面,支持用户操作。

2. 高可用性设计

为了确保系统的稳定性和可靠性,可以采取以下措施:

  • 负载均衡:通过负载均衡技术,分散服务器压力。
  • 容灾备份:在关键节点部署备份系统,防止单点故障。
  • 自动化监控:实时监控系统运行状态,自动报警和修复。

五、高校可视化大屏的应用场景

1. 校园安全管理

通过可视化大屏,可以实时监控校园内的安全状况,包括:

  • 视频监控:实时显示校园各区域的监控画面。
  • 异常行为检测:利用AI技术检测异常行为,及时发出预警。

2. 教学管理

可视化大屏可以为教学管理提供以下支持:

  • 课程安排可视化:展示课程时间表、教室占用情况。
  • 学生出勤统计:实时显示学生出勤率和迟到早退情况。

3. 科研支持

可视化大屏可以为科研工作提供数据支持:

  • 科研数据可视化:展示科研项目的进展、数据分布。
  • 科研资源管理:可视化展示实验室、设备的使用情况。

4. 校园资源管理

可视化大屏可以优化校园资源的管理和利用:

  • 设备状态监控:实时显示校园设备的运行状态。
  • 能源管理:监控校园的能源消耗情况,优化能源使用。

六、总结与展望

高校可视化大屏的数据采集与实时渲染技术是一项复杂的系统工程,涉及数据采集、处理、渲染等多个环节。通过合理选择技术方案和优化系统架构,可以实现高效、稳定的可视化效果。未来,随着人工智能和大数据技术的不断发展,高校可视化大屏将更加智能化、个性化,为校园管理和服务提供更强大的支持。


如果您对高校可视化大屏的技术实现感兴趣,或者希望了解更详细的技术方案,欢迎申请试用相关工具和服务,了解更多实用信息:申请试用&https://www.dtstack.com/?src=bbs

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料